Common Admission Requirements For Doctor of Social Work (DSW) Degree ProgramsIn Linganore, Maryland
The admission process for DSW programs in Linganore typically involves several key requirements:
Master’s Degree: Applicants must have earned a Master of Social Work (MSW) from an accredited program, with a solid academic record.
Professional Experience: A minimum of two years of supervised post-MSW practice is often required. Experience in mental health, clinical practice, or community service adds considerable value to applications.
Letters of Recommendation: Most programs request two or three letters from academic or professional references who can attest to the applicant's qualifications and commitment to social work.
Personal Statement: Candidates must submit a personal statement, usually consisting of their motivation for pursuing a DSW, professional goals, and perspectives on the future of social work.
Interview: An interview may be part of the application process to assess fit for the program and commitment to the profession.
Standardized Tests: While some schools may require GRE scores, others may waive this requirement based on the applicant’s academic history or work experience.
Prospective students should check with individual institutions for specific requirements, as variations may exist.
Cost & Financial Aid Options For Doctor of Social Work (DSW) Degree Programs In Linganore, Maryland
Tuition costs for DSW programs in Linganore can range significantly based on the institution and its resources. Typically, students can expect tuition fees to fall within the following range:
Tuition: Annual tuition for a DSW program often ranges from $20,000 to $40,000.
Additional Fees: Students should budget for fees related to course materials, registration, and possibly technology fees depending on the program’s structure.
Financial Aid Options:
- Federal Student Aid: Applicants can compl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) to determine eligibility for federal loans and grants.
- Institutional Scholarships: Many universities offer scholarships specifically for social work students based on merit or need.
- Work-Study Programs: Certain programs might provide opportunities for students to work part-time within the campus or related organizations.
- State Grants: Maryland state grants could provide additional financial support for students pursuing higher education.
By thoroughly researching financial options, students can effectively manage educational costs while pursuing their DSW.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Doctor of Social Work (DSW) Degree Programs In Linganore, Maryland
What is the difference between a DSW and a PhD in Social Work?
- A DSW focuses on advanced practice and leadership, whereas a PhD emphasizes research and academic theory.
Can I work while pursuing my DSW?
- Yes, many students balance work and studies, especially if their jobs relate to social work.
How long does it typically take to complete a DSW program?
- Most DSW programs require about 3 to 4 years of full-time study.
Are online DSW programs available in Linganore?
- Some universities may offer online or hybrid DSW programs for greater flexibility.
What types of jobs can I get with a DSW?
- Options include clinical social work, administration, policy-making, and education roles.
Do I need to complete a dissertation?
- Dissertation requirements vary by program; some may require a capstone project instead.
Is there a demand for social workers in Maryland?
- Yes, there is a growing demand for social workers, particularly those with advanced degrees.
Are there scholarships specifically for social work students?
- Yes, various scholarships are available through universities and external organizations.
What licensure do I need after obtaining a DSW?
- Most graduates pursue licensure as a clinical social worker (LCSW-C) in Maryland.
